Ketika berbicara tentang self-hosting GitLab CE, memilih Virtual Private Server (VPS) yang tepat sangat penting untuk performa, efisiensi biaya, dan skalabilitas. GitLab CE bisa menjadi sumber daya intensif tergantung pada jumlah pengguna dan repository, sehingga memilih VPS terbaik menjadi hal yang sangat utama untuk pengalaman yang lancar. Dalam artikel ini, kami akan membandingkan opsi VPS yang paling cocok untuk GitLab CE di tahun 2026, dengan fokus pada tiga penyedia utama: Contabo, Hetzner, dan DigitalOcean.
Fitur Utama yang Perlu Dipertimbangkan untuk GitLab CE
- Sumber Daya CPU: GitLab dapat membutuhkan banyak CPU, terutama selama operasi CI/CD.
- Memori (RAM): RAM yang cukup sangat penting untuk menangani pengguna secara bersamaan dan pekerjaan latar belakang.
- Penyimpanan: SSD memberikan kecepatan baca/tulis yang lebih cepat yang sangat penting untuk repository Git.
- Performa Jaringan: Latency rendah dan bandwidth tinggi meningkatkan responsivitas instance GitLab Anda.
- Skalabilitas: Kemampuan untuk dengan mudah menambah sumber daya sangat penting seiring pertumbuhan proyek.
Perbandingan VPS untuk GitLab CE
| Penyedia | Harga | Core CPU | RAM | Penyimpanan | Terbaik Untuk | Keunggulan |
|---|---|---|---|---|---|---|
| Contabo | 5,99 EUR/bulan | 4 | 8 GB | 200 GB HDD | Instansi Menengah hingga Besar | Harga per GB terbaik di pasar; cocok untuk media server. |
| Hetzner Cloud | 4,15 EUR/bulan | 2 | 2 GB | 20 GB SSD | Pengembangan & Pengujian | Performa-harga terbaik; API dan Terraform yang hebat. |
| DigitalOcean | 6 USD/bulan | 2 | 2 GB | 50 GB SSD | Deploy Sederhana | Marketplace 1-Klik menghemat waktu; dokumentasi terbaik. |
1. VPS Contabo - Terbaik untuk Proyek Besar
Contabo VPS adalah pilihan yang sangat baik untuk pengguna yang ingin menghost instance GitLab CE yang lebih besar. Harganya 5,99 EUR/bulan, menawarkan 4 core CPU, 8 GB RAM, dan 200 GB penyimpanan, membuatnya sangat cocok untuk tim besar yang membutuhkan penyimpanan yang signifikan. Penyimpanan yang luas juga ideal untuk mengelola banyak proyek, repository, dan pipeline CI/CD.
Keunggulan:
- Sangat terjangkau dengan harga per GB yang tak tertandingi.
- Penyimpanan besar untuk solusi backup.
- Cocok untuk hosting media server bersamaan dengan GitLab.
Bagi yang tertarik, Anda bisa cek Contabo di sini.
2. Hetzner Cloud - Rasio Harga-Performa Terbaik
Hetzner Cloud adalah VPS favorit pengembang yang dikenal karena rasio harga-performa yang sangat baik. Dengan biaya hanya 4,15 EUR/bulan, Anda mendapatkan 2 core CPU, 2 GB RAM, dan 20 GB SSD. Meskipun tidak sebesar Contabo, Hetzner memungkinkan pengembang memanfaatkan API kuat dan provider Terraform untuk deployment otomatis dan skalabilitas.
Keunggulan:
- Harga kompetitif dengan performa tinggi.
- Infrastruktur yang sangat cocok untuk lingkungan pengembangan.
- Dukungan API yang kuat untuk integrasi DevOps.
Cek Hetzner Cloud di sini.
3. DigitalOcean - Terbaik untuk Kemudahan Penggunaan
Jika prioritas Anda adalah kesederhanaan dan kemudahan pengelolaan, DigitalOcean adalah pilihan utama, dengan harga 6 USD/bulan. Menyediakan 2 core CPU, 2 GB RAM, dan 50 GB SSD. Fitur andalannya adalah marketplace 1-Klik yang memungkinkan pengembang mengatur GitLab CE dengan cepat dan efisien.
Keunggulan:
- Dokumentasi terbaik di industri memudahkan proses setup.
- Layanan yang dapat di-scaling cocok untuk startup dan proyek baru.
- Dukungan komunitas dan tutorial yang solid.
Jelajahi DigitalOcean di sini.
Kesimpulan
Setiap penyedia VPS memiliki keunggulan masing-masing, membuatnya cocok untuk jenis proyek yang berbeda. Contabo ideal untuk tim besar dengan kebutuhan penyimpanan, Hetzner Cloud unggul dalam lingkungan pengembangan dengan anggaran terbatas, dan DigitalOcean menawarkan platform yang mudah digunakan untuk setup cepat.
Untuk perbandingan VPS yang lebih lengkap, kunjungi perbandingan VPS lengkap kami. Saat melakukan self-hosting GitLab CE, pertimbangkan kebutuhan unik Anda dengan cermat agar dapat memilih opsi terbaik.
FAQ (Pertanyaan yang Sering Diajukan)
1. Apa saja persyaratan minimum untuk self-hosting GitLab CE?
Untuk self-hosting GitLab CE, Anda harus mempertimbangkan minimal 2 core CPU, 4 GB RAM, dan setidaknya 10 GB penyimpanan. Namun, ini adalah persyaratan minimum. Tergantung pada penggunaan Anda, seperti jumlah pengguna dan repository, Anda mungkin perlu meningkatkan sumber daya agar performa tetap lancar. Setup yang lebih kuat dengan RAM dan CPU yang lebih banyak akan sangat meningkatkan pengalaman pengguna, terutama untuk tim yang menggunakan fitur CI/CD.
2. Bisakah saya meningkatkan sumber daya VPS saya nanti?
Ya, sebagian besar penyedia VPS, termasuk Contabo, Hetzner, dan DigitalOcean, menawarkan opsi yang fleksibel untuk meningkatkan sumber daya. Jika kebutuhan proyek Anda bertambah, Anda biasanya dapat meng-upgrade CPU, RAM, dan penyimpanan dengan gangguan minimal. Penting untuk merencanakan sebelum mencapai batas saat ini agar transisi berjalan lancar dan instance GitLab Anda tetap tersedia.
3. Seberapa aman self-hosting GitLab CE di VPS?
Self-hosting GitLab CE di VPS bisa aman jika Anda menerapkan langkah-langkah keamanan yang tepat. Gunakan HTTPS untuk koneksi aman, konfigurasi SSH key untuk akses, dan rutin memperbarui perangkat lunak Anda untuk menambal kerentanan potensial. Selain itu, pastikan VPS Anda menyediakan solusi backup yang handal untuk melindungi data. Memilih VPS dari penyedia terpercaya yang dikenal menjaga praktik keamanan yang baik dapat meningkatkan ketahanan setup Anda terhadap ancaman. Selalu ikuti praktik terbaik keamanan server di forum seperti r/selfhosted atau awesome-selfhosted.
Dengan memilih VPS yang tepat dan menerapkan protokol keamanan yang dianjurkan, Anda dapat menciptakan lingkungan yang aman untuk proyek Anda di GitLab CE.